Embrace Your Mission
Melanie Rigney
October 22, 2022
Daniel Comboni’s first missionary trip to Africa ended in failure. He returned home to Italy and came up with the idea to directly involve African Christians in evangelizing their sisters and brothers. This inclusive effort bore much fruit.
